5 out of 5 stars The real flavour of the region   September 10, 2006
 21 out of 25 found this review helpful

For anyone who knows, or who would like to know the region, this is a must. Unlke so many authors of this type of book, Ms Murrills has clearly spent many years getting to know and understand the area, and really has the feel of the untranslatable 'terroir'. She also has the talent to pass this underestanding on to her readers.
A plus - the illustrations are delightful.
